-
公开(公告)号:CN107301042B
公开(公告)日:2020-07-14
申请号:CN201710417550.7
申请日:2017-06-06
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: G06F9/4401 , G06F11/10 , G06F11/22
摘要: 本发明涉及一种带自检功能的SoC应用程序引导方法,在运行应用程序前将应用程序从FLASH搬运到SRAM去,并将应用程序的第一行指令地址赋予CPU的PC指针,启动程序运行的一种引导功能模块。本发明所述程序引导方法在搬运应用程序前对应用程序运行的SRAM进行检查,并对应用程序搬运的正确性进行检查,在应用程序运行前保证运行目标及其运行环境的正确性。本发明通过程序上传的一致性校验、搬运前、后的校验,保证了从源程序到每次运行程序的正确性,保证了运行环境功能完好,一旦程序发生故障,能够快速进行故障定位。
-
公开(公告)号:CN107302481B
公开(公告)日:2020-04-10
申请号:CN201710358368.9
申请日:2017-05-19
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: H04L12/40 , H04L12/403 , G06F13/42 , H04L12/26 , H04L12/24
摘要: 本发明公开了一种1553B总线网络及串行总线网络的跨网状态可靠切换方法,具体为:(1)、1553B总线网络中的Smaster向Sslave发送状态切换命令消息;(2)、Sslave对状态切换命令消息进行解析,得到需要进行状态切换的所有站点;(3)、Sslave向除网络站点Sslave之外串行总线网络中的需要进行状态切换的站点Ui转发切换命令消息,查询状态切换好回复消息;(4)、Sslave根据各站点切换状态和自身状态切换好消息,形成跨网状态切换回复消息发送给Smaster;(5)、Smaster根据跨网状态切换回复消息,判断所有需要切换的站点的状态是否与所发出的状态切换命令相对应,从而判断要求切换的各站点是否均完成状态切换。实现了1553B中任意站点对混合网络中的其他站点的状态控制功能。
-
-
公开(公告)号:CN107505883A
公开(公告)日:2017-12-22
申请号:CN201710637376.7
申请日:2017-07-31
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: G05B19/048 , G05B23/02
摘要: 本发明公开了一种基于微控制器的高可靠双冗余集成控制模块,包括互为冗余的主控制模块、从控制模块;主控制模块、从控制模块接收外部输入的I/O型控制信号输出命令后,产生相应的有效I/O控制信号,主控制模块、从控制模块产生的两路I/O控制信号进行逻辑“或”运算操作,任意一路I/O控制信号“有效”时,输出“有效”的I/O控制信号;互为冗余的主控制模块、从控制模块的微控制器实时采集对方所输出的I/O型控制信号状态,并根据主、从控制模块相应的I/O型控制信号状态进行故障判读,并将判读结果输出,实时采集所控I/O控制信号执行结果并输出。本发明增加了控制信号发送的稳定性和可靠性。
-
公开(公告)号:CN107102921A
公开(公告)日:2017-08-29
申请号:CN201710179456.2
申请日:2017-03-23
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: G06F11/22
摘要: 本发明提供了一种面向带I/O型数字量异步端口SoC的数字量监测方法,采用I/O型数字量状态端口实时记录I/O型数字量状态;采用I/O型数字量异步数据端口实时存储最多N次最近的I/O型数字量状态端口值和变化次数;采用中断响应程序响应I/O型数字量状态端口的变化,分析I/O型数字量异步数据端口所记载的每个I/O型数字量最近nCount次翻转变化情况。本发明采用I/O型数字量变化记录和读取的异步方式,保证高实时性的基础上降低了对处理器的性能要求,提高了I/O型数字量变化的敏感性;采用多次读取反复比对克服了同一端口软硬件异步读写的问题,提高了对输入的I/O型数字量的变化状态进行监测的可靠性和忠实性。
-
公开(公告)号:CN107026703A
公开(公告)日:2017-08-08
申请号:CN201710357135.7
申请日:2017-05-19
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: H04J3/06
CPC分类号: H04J3/0638
摘要: 本发明公开了一种混合网络中的级联式时间同步方法,包括如下步骤:(1)、父层网络的时间同步控制站点向共享适配站点发送时间同步消息;(2)、共享适配站点收到时间同步消息之后,进行解析得到当前时刻父层时间系统时间Tsyn,同时记录时间同步消息收到时刻的本地时间Tlocal_syn;(3)、共享适配站点根据自身的子层时间系统时间Tlocal,对子层网络中的其他站点进行时间同步;(4)、共享适配站点收到子层网络中的任意其他站点发送的带有子层时间系统时间标记tsub的时间标记消息之后,将tsub转换为父层网络中的时间值TafterSyn,反馈至父层网络实现混合网络之间的时间同步。本发明在不影响父层网络和子层网络时间同步的基础上,将两层通信网中的各个站点时间同步。
-
公开(公告)号:CN106646190A
公开(公告)日:2017-05-10
申请号:CN201611023953.5
申请日:2016-11-14
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: G01R31/28
CPC分类号: G01R31/282
摘要: 本发明提供了一种通用火工品时序电路测试方法,包括低压测试和/或高压测试,所述低压测试包括单桥测试和/或双桥测试和/或阈值测试,所述双桥测试包括左桥测试和/或右桥测试,所述阈值测试包括低阈值测试和/或高阈值测试。本发明能够进行低压测试和/或高压测试,且覆盖了单桥、双桥等多种形式的火工品时序电路形式,能够减少测试设备的种类,简化测试环节,有效提高了火工品时序电路的测试效率,能够确保火工品时序电路在出厂验收前和导弹飞行过程中功能正常,大大提高了火工品时序电路的可靠性。
-
公开(公告)号:CN105337592A
公开(公告)日:2016-02-17
申请号:CN201510544258.2
申请日:2015-08-28
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
IPC分类号: H03K5/19
摘要: 本发明提供一种定周期脉冲周期稳定性监测方法,包括,步骤S1,将输入的待监测的周期为T、误差为σ的定周期脉冲信号接入到微控制器的计数器输入端口中,计数器对脉冲信号进行计数;步骤S2,通过在微控制器的顺序多任务中循环查询计数器的变化状态来实现对定周期脉冲信号周期稳定性的监测。本发明所述方法无需同步信号的电路,简化了外围监测电路的设计,提高了监测功能的稳定性。
-
-
公开(公告)号:CN105183688A
公开(公告)日:2015-12-23
申请号:CN201510544361.7
申请日:2015-08-28
申请人: 北京航天自动控制研究所 , 中国运载火箭技术研究院
CPC分类号: G06F13/4282 , G06F13/405
摘要: 一种基于串口网络的IO数字量监测端口扩展方法,包括,S1、将带FPGA监测逻辑的监测板卡挂接到由一块带微控制器的板卡控制的串口网络上;S2、由分布在监测板卡上的FPGA监测逻辑对I/O型数字量进行监测,并将FPGA监测逻辑对I/O型数字量的监测结果通过串口网络传给微控制器;S3、由微控制器完成对I/O型数字量监测结果信息的整理校正,提供监测报告。本发明所述方法将扩展的I/O型数字量端口在其他板卡上实现,通过串口总线将测试信息传回到微处理器板卡上,这样在微处理器板卡上无需实现监测I/O型数字量相关功能的电路,从而可以使微处理器板卡更好地完成其他功能。
-
-
-
-
-
-
-
-
-